Martijn Visser commented on FLINK-3154:
---------------------------------------

No, there is currently no plan for upgrading to a newer version of Kryo because 
it would break savepoint compatibility.

> Flink's Kryo version is outdated and could be updated to a newer version, 
> e.g. kryo-3.0.3.
> From ML: we cannot bumping the Kryo version easily - the serialization format 
> changed (that's why they have a new major version), which would render all 
> Flink savepoints and checkpoints incompatible.
